Why should I consider organic methods for blackberry farming?

When it comes to growing blackberries, organic methods offer several compelling advantages. Firstly, organic farming eliminates the use of synthetic pesticides and fertilizers, reducing the potential health risks associated with chemical exposure.

Organic blackberries are free from harmful residues, making them a safer choice for consumers. Additionally, organic practices prioritize soil health and biodiversity, creating a sustainable ecosystem that benefits both the plants and the surrounding environment.

How does organic farming benefit the environment?

Organic farming practices have significant positive impacts on the environment. By avoiding the use of synthetic pesticides and fertilizers, organic farmers reduce water and soil pollution, safeguarding aquatic ecosystems and promoting biodiversity.

Organic methods also prioritize soil conservation and fertility through techniques like crop rotation, cover cropping, and composting. These practices help improve soil structure, water retention, and nutrient cycling, contributing to long-term sustainability and reducing soil degradation.

What are the potential cost savings of organic blackberry farming?

While organic farming practices may require initial investments and adjustments, they can lead to long-term cost savings. Organic farmers focus on building healthy, fertile soils that require fewer inputs over time.

By using organic fertilizers, compost, and natural pest control methods, growers can reduce their reliance on expensive synthetic inputs. Moreover, organic farming often involves techniques like integrated pest management (IPM), which minimize the need for costly pest control measures.

Over the years, these cost-saving practices can make organic blackberry farming economically viable and sustainable.

Are there any specific organic techniques for pest control in blackberry farming?

Absolutely! Organic blackberry farming utilizes a variety of effective pest control techniques. One commonly used method is integrated pest management (IPM), which involves a combination of preventive measures, biological control agents, and cultural practices to manage pests.

For example, attracting beneficial insects like ladybugs and lacewings to the farm helps control harmful pests naturally. Additionally, physical barriers, such as nets and row covers, can be used to exclude pests from blackberry plants.

PestOrganic TechniqueDescription
Blackberry psyllidBeneficial insectsIntroduce predator insects like ladybugs and lacewings to control psyllid populations naturally.
Spotted wing drosophilaTrap cropsPlant early maturing trap crops such as strawberries or cherries to divert and monitor SWD activity away from blackberries.
Raspberry crown borerSanitationPrune and destroy infested canes during the dormant season to prevent the spread of raspberry crown borer larvae.
Japanese beetlesHandpickingInspect blackberry plants daily and manually remove Japanese beetles by shaking them into a container of soapy water.
Blackberry lace bugsNeem oilApply a solution of neem oil and water to control lace bug populations and reduce damage to blackberry foliage.

How does organic farming contribute to soil health in blackberry production?

Organic farming plays a crucial role in maintaining soil health in blackberry production. Through the use of organic matter, cover crops, and crop rotation, organic farmers promote soil fertility, structure, and microbial activity.

Organic matter, such as compost and animal manure, enriches the soil with essential nutrients and enhances its water-holding capacity. Cover crops, such as legumes or grasses, help prevent soil erosion, suppress weeds, and improve soil structure.

Crop rotation, on the other hand, disrupts pest and disease cycles and promotes balanced nutrient uptake. These organic practices work synergistically to create healthy and thriving soils, ensuring the long-term success of blackberry farms.

Can organic practices help prevent soil erosion in blackberry farms?

Certainly! Organic practices are effective in preventing soil erosion in blackberry farms. By employing techniques like cover cropping, contour plowing, and terracing, organic farmers reduce the risk of soil erosion caused by wind and water.

Cover crops protect the soil from erosion by shielding it from rainfall impact and reducing surface runoff. Contour plowing involves tilling along the contours of the land, minimizing soil erosion by directing water flow.

Terracing, on the other hand, creates leveled platforms on hilly terrains, reducing the speed and impact of water runoff. These organic methods not only protect the soil but also contribute to overall farm sustainability.

How do organic farming methods support biodiversity in blackberry cultivation?

Organic farming methods play a crucial role in supporting biodiversity in blackberry cultivation. Here are some ways in which organic farming methods support biodiversity:

  • Preservation of beneficial insects: Organic farmers encourage the presence of beneficial insects, such as pollinators and predators, by avoiding the use of harmful pesticides. These insects help in pollination, controlling pest populations, and maintaining a balanced ecosystem within blackberry fields.
  • Soil health promotion: Organic farming focuses on nurturing the soil through practices like composting, cover cropping, and crop rotation. These methods enhance soil fertility, structure, and microbial activity, creating a hospitable environment for a wide range of organisms, including earthworms, beneficial bacteria, and fungi.
  • Protection of natural habitats: Organic farming practices often include the preservation of natural habitats within or around blackberry fields. These habitats serve as homes for various wildlife species, including birds, mammals, and beneficial insects. By providing undisturbed spaces, organic farming helps support the biodiversity of the surrounding ecosystem.
  • Non-toxic environment: Organic farmers refrain from using synthetic pesticides and herbicides that can harm non-target species. This reduction in chemical exposure contributes to the well-being of birds, small mammals, and other organisms that may be negatively affected by toxic substances.
  • Genetic diversity: Organic farmers often prioritize heirlooms and diverse varieties of blackberries. By cultivating a wide range of genetic resources, they help preserve unique flavors, adaptability, and resilience within the blackberry crop, contributing to the overall biodiversity of the agricultural landscape.

Are there any risks or challenges associated with organic methods for blackberry farming?

While organic farming has numerous benefits, it also presents certain challenges and risks. Organic pest control methods may require more labor-intensive practices, such as manual weed removal or insect monitoring.

This can increase the workload and labor costs for farmers. Additionally, organic farming requires careful planning and management to ensure proper nutrient balance, pest control, and disease prevention.

Farmers need to stay informed about organic farming practices, attend training sessions, and adapt to changing conditions. Despite these challenges, the rewards of organic blackberry farming in terms of environmental sustainability, consumer demand, and long-term profitability make it a worthwhile endeavor.
